[0050] A method for improving the tension-compression fatigue life of metal workpieces is specifically applied to the embodiment of fastening workpieces (here, bolts are used as an example for fastening workpieces), comprising the following steps:
[0051] In the length direction of bolt 1 (as attached figure 1 , 2 , 3 and 4 in the direction indicated by L) to carry out strong tension treatment on bolt 1, that is, to apply a set tensile force exceeding its yield strength but lower than its tensile strength, when the tensile force applied to bolt 1 reaches the expected setting After pulling the tension, remove the tension to improve the tension-compression fatigue characteristics of the bolt 1. The time for the strong pulling treatment is to remove the pulling force as soon as the expected pulling force is reached, or it can be kept for a certain period of time (called holding time) after reaching the expected pulling force as required and then remove the pulling force.

Embodiment 3
[0061] For bolt 1, choose M10×85 grade 8.8 carbon steel bolts, the yield strength of M10×85 grade 8.8 carbon steel bolts is 37.1KN, and the tensile strength is 46.4KN. Apply a pulling force of 40KN to the bolt 1 through a tensioning machine, and remove the tensioning force when the tensioning force applied by the tensioning machine reaches the expected pulling force (that is, the pulling force of 40KN). After the 40KN strong tension treatment, under the pretightening force of 5.5KN and the alternating load condition of ±5.5KN, compared with the bolt 1 without treatment, the tension and compression fatigue life of the bolt 1 after the strong tension treatment Got a 12x improvement.
